Comprehending Cellular Aging
Cellular aging, likewise described as senescence, is an intricate process affected by a range of elements. As cells divide and duplicate with time, they collect damage due to environmental stress factors, metabolic procedures, and even the intrinsic body clock referred to as telomeres-- protective caps on the ends of chromosomes that reduce with each cell department.

1. Senolytics
These drugs selectively get rid of senescent cells, which have been discovered to contribute to age-related diseases. Studies suggest that clearing these cells may reverse some elements of aging.
2. Gene Therapy
Gene modifying techniques like CRISPR deal possible opportunities for fixing defective genes associated with aging and enhancing cellular repair mechanisms.
3. Telomere Extension
Research study is continuous in strategies to lengthen telomeres, possibly reversing cellular aging procedures.
